Finding loading on each major axis?

Hello,
I am a first time user working on a simple pick and place operation for one of my classes. We are supposed to use run a simulation for our motion path and display "the trace output indicating the load that each axis motor of the robot is placed under". I was not sure how to enable this in the simulation's signal setup, so I just enabled the physics tab for all 6 of the joints. When I ran the simulation I had no readings for the analog signals but my virtual digital values were appearing (see image below). I also noticed on my controller's system I/O configuration all signals were grayed out except for the virtual I/O's I added myself (see image below). I am using a virtual controller and robot.
Is there something I haven't linked correctly or am I just going about the simulation the wrong way? What is the proper way to output the load data for each axis?
